When we set out to create a wheelset built purely for speed, we wanted to make it more than just fast. Not that being fast wasn't a priority, but we were tired of wheels that only performed well in a straight line. In the end, we developed the CLX 64, the fastest wheel that we've ever tested. Not only is it the fastest in the tunnel, but its prestige has been verified with Gold Medals in the men's road race, time trial, and team time trial at the 2016 UCI World Championships. One of the first questions we get about the CLX 64 is, "Why 64mm instead of 65mm?" To put it simply, it's because 64mm simply tested faster than 65mm. One millimeter, that's how deep our testing goes. Having an in-house wind tunnel allows us to run every possible variation, and after two years of development, 80 variations in rim design, and nearly 300 hours studying tire and frame interactions in the Win Tunnel, we found 64mm to be the fastest iteration for normal riding conditions. In fact, it's even faster than the 80-plus-millimeter-deep wheels they were tested against. Being able to use a shape that's nearly 20mm shallower than the competition, yet just as low in drag, makes for a wheel that has drastically less side force and steering torque. This translates to less buffeting and more confidence in even the gustiest winds. Another positive of a shallower rim depth is the reduction in weight that follows using less material. Many deep carbon wheels feel "slow" due to their high inertia value. What's that? Inertia is the amount of force it takes to accelerate or decelerate, and wheels that are built around heavier rims lack the liveliness that many riders crave. Being over a half-a-pound lighter than the other wheels in its aero category, the CLX 64 accelerates, decelerates, and changes direction with less effort. The rim is not the only component of the CLX 64 that contributes to its aero prowess though, in order to create the fastest wheels, we focused on the wheels as a system, not just a rim with "other parts," and our Aero Flange (AF) hubs play a significant role. Designed completely in the Win Tunnel, our AF hubs feature an incredibly small frontal aero, without sacrificing stiffness, making them aerodynamically efficient. Taking the advantage a step further, these wheels were developed to work in harmony with modern-width 24C tires. The 21mm internal rim width spreads the tire out, in this case to 26C, making it seamlessly meet the rim. Not only does this create a system with low aerodynamic drag, but one that has exceptionally low rolling resistance and inspiring grip in the corners. And to make sure we checked all of the feature boxes, we also made the rim tubeless-ready. To top off the multitude of performance features of the rim, we chose the highest quality build components to pair the CLX 64 front with. Starting with DT Swiss Aerolite bladed spokes, which test faster than their round counterparts in the Win Tunnel, we hand-laced the 64 rim to our AF hubs that house CeramicSpeed's legendary bearings. Why hand-built? When we set out to create a lightweight wheelset, we didn't want it to be "just another climbing wheel." We wanted to provide the lightest wheelset out there with the aerodynamic attributes of something twice its depth. One wheel that'll get you to the base of a climb quickly and up it as efficiently as possible, yet still be strong enough for day-to-day abuse. It was a tall order, but in the end, the CLX 32 gave us more than what we asked for. Our design process started with a low overall weight at the forefront, as we knew what weight we could hit with the information and technology we had available. With that weight in mind, we then turned our focus to aerodynamics and began an iterative process of designing and testing over 150 individual rims to find the optimal shape. These innumerable Computational Fluid Dynamics (CFD) models, Win Tunnel hours, and shots of espresso left us with a 32mm-deep shape that boasts more logged wind tunnel time than any other wheel in its category. Once we found the most aerodynamic shape, at the 32-millimter depth, we came back to the weight focus and proceeded to experiment with over 40 different layup methods to reach our desired weight. And this made the CLX 32 lighter and faster than every other competitor in the lightweight wheel category. For the CLX 32 rear clincher, we mated the rim to our Aero Flange (AF) series hub with DT Swiss Aero spokes to create the best overall system. This results in a 730-gram, 21mm-wide (internal width) rear wheel with an extremely low inertia value. In cycling, inertia relates to the amount of force it takes to accelerate or decelerate, so wheels that are built with lightweight rims, like the CLX 32, result in a lower inertia value that creates a lively wheel that allows you to accelerate, decelerate, and change direction with less effort. But why so wide? Well, additional width does three primary things for a rim, it provides additional structural strength, it allows for a clean rim and tire interface when using wide tires (resulting in enhanced aerodynamics and faster rolling properties), and it better supports the tire in hard cornering. This boosts both predictable grip and confidence when things get twisty on the descents.
